Active Monitoring
• PerfSonar– Network distributed nodes • Geographically distributed w/core nodes• Perform periodic testing• Minimally intrusive• Reveals problems passive testing cannot

Passive: Netflow
• Passively sampled (1:1500 packets)– Done at the core-network edge, outgoing– Exported for archive (nfdump)– Currently analyzed with Excel

Total Traffic Transported
• 60-70 TB/day peaks (March 2012):– 1.4 PB in January– 1.5 PB in February– 1.7 PB in March– 0.8 PB in April
